Rumor Engines From March 2025

March 4, 2025 – Where There’s Smoke There’s Fire

Status: Solved

Those pillars of smoke belonged to the Kharadron Overlords and their fancy Zontari Endrin Dock. Perfect for parking your Sky Vessels near.

March 11, 2025 – Get A Rope

Status: Solved

These ropes are also a part of the Zontari Endrin Dock. It figures you’d need some stable rigging to get around on when you’re mid-flight in a Sky Vessel or docking!

March 18, 2925 – Splash Down

Status: Solved

Another teaser from the Mortal Realms. This one is the Manifestation from the Idoneth Deepkin. Also known as the Incarnate of the Deep and their two Abyssal Tendrils. That’s still one really cool kit!

March 25, 2025 – It’s A Drill

Status: Solved

The massive drill was indeed a drill. And it belonged to the terrifying Knight Ruinator. It’s not looking to mine for gold with that thing!

Well that’s all from March 2025. I guess all of these teasers DID get revealed. So no one year later surprise reveals from the Rumor Engine at AdeptiCon 2026. Oh well.
